By-poll for NA-190 on April 12

Published February 22, 2004

ISLAMABAD, Feb 21: Chief Election Commissioner Irshad Hasan Khan on Saturday announced by-election in NA-190, Bahawalnagar-III, on April 12 to fill the National Assembly seat that became vacant due to the death of Labour and Overseas Pakistanis Minister Abdul Sattar Khan Laleka.

According to the election scheduled, March 9 and 10 will be the dates for filing nomination papers and the scrutiny of the papers will be done on March 12.

March 15 is the last date for filing appeals against the rejection or acceptance of nomination papers, which will be decided by March 18. Nomination papers can by withdrawn till March 22 and the revised list will be published on March 24.
